WHAT IS THE USES OF PLC?
Answer Posted / kumaraswamy
plc is a programmable logic controller ,it is a digitally
operated electronics system, which uses a programmable
memory for the industrial environment, which uses a
programmable memory for the internal storage of user
oriented instructions, for implementing specific functions
such as logic, sequencing, timing counting and arithmetic .
To control through digital or analog input and outputs
various types of machines or processors .
